Why Exact Aquarium Measurements Matter
An aquarium is not simply an ornamental glass box; it is a closed biological environment. Every gallon of water counts when it concerns keeping steady water specifications, making sure adequate oxygenation, and supplying enough swimming area.
When people count on guesswork, they often face typical risks:
- Overstocking: Misjudging water volume results in keeping too lots of fish, which quickly overwhelms the biological filtration.
- Stunted Growth: Certain Fish Tank Calculator require specific swimming lengths and water volumes to grow healthily.
- Structural Failures: Water weighs roughly 8.34 pounds per gallon. A relatively small 50-gallon tank weighs over 500 pounds when completely set up, making structural support a crucial estimation.
The Mathematics Behind an Aquarium Size Calculator
The majority of standard aquariums are rectangle-shaped prisms. Determining their volume relies on fundamental geometry, though conversion factors are required to translate cubic inches into gallons or liters.
Standard Volume Formulas
To discover the volume of a rectangular tank in inches:
- Cubic Inches: ₤ text Length times text Width times text Height = text Overall Cubic Inches ₤
- Gallons (US): ₤ text Cubic Inches div 231 = text Gallons ₤
- Liters: ₤ text Cubic Inches times 0.016387 = text Liters ₤
Note: Always step from the within glass panels instead of the external frame to get the most accurate water volume price quote.

While an aquarium size calculator supplies the overall water volume, the shape of the tank is just as important as the numbers. 2 tanks might both hold 40 gallons of water, but they can support completely various types of marine life depending on their dimensions.
Horizontal vs. Vertical Tanks
- Long and Shallow Tanks: These supply a large area at the water-air user interface. This promotes remarkable oxygen exchange and gives education fish lots of horizontal swimming length.
- Tall and Narrow Tanks: While visually striking and space-saving in a space, high tanks have less area for gas exchange. They can also make aquascaping and regular upkeep (like scraping algae from the bottom) rather difficult.
Elements to Consider When Using an Aquarium Calculator
Deciding on a tank size involves balancing numerous real-world variables. Before locking in your measurements, evaluate the following criteria:
- Available Floor Space and Weight Capacity: Ensure the designated piece of furniture or Aquarium Weight Calculator stand is rated to hold the overall weight calculated (water + glass + substrate + design). Never put a heavy tank on standard household furnishings not created for dynamic loads.
- The "One Inch Per Gallon" Myth: A historical guideline recommended that a person inch of fish needs one gallon of water. Modern aquarists know this is largely inaccurate. A 6-inch Oscar Fish Tank Stock Calculator produces vastly more biological waste than six 1-inch neon tetras, in spite of taking up the very same theoretical "inch" quota.
- Schooling and Territorial Requirements: Active swimmers like Danios require length to dart back and forth, despite overall water volume. Territorial bottom-dwellers, like certain Cichlids, need extensive flooring area (footprint) to establish and defend limits.
- Upkeep Effort: Larger volumes of water dilute waste products more gradually, making water specifications more stable. Paradoxically, large aquariums are often easier to keep balanced than small nano tanks, which can experience quick chemistry shifts.
Step-by-Step Guide to Planning Your Tank Setup
Once an online aquarium size calculator yields a preferred tank dimension, enthusiasts must follow a structured planning procedure:
- Determine Stocking Goals: Write down the specific types of fish, invertebrates, and live plants meant for the environment.
- Represent Displacement: Remember that rocks, driftwood, gravel, and filters displace water. A 55-gallon tank may just hold around 48 to 50 actual gallons of water once totally decorated.
- Compute Equipment Needs: Use the volume output to measure coordinating equipment:
- Filters: Look for a filtration system ranked for at least 1.5 to 2 times the tank's actual volume.
- Heaters: A basic general rule is 3 to 5 watts of heating power per gallon of water.
- Lighting: Intensity requirements differ wildly depending upon whether the tank includes low-light plants or a high-tech planted aquascape.
